Toby's Resorts & Restaurant is a small, centrally located hotel on the hip strip of Montego Bay. Toby's Resorts & Restaurant is geared towards the easy going and adventurous tourists and returning residents. Toby's Resorts & Restaurant provides rooms with Private Balcony, Two Twin Beds, King or Queen Size Beds, Private Bathroom with Shower, Cable TV, Telephone and Restaurant & Bar Service.

I am solo female traveler in my 20's. This was my 3rd time to Jamaica. Normally I got to Ocho Rios but this time I stayed in Negril for 2 days (at Country Country Beach Cottages) and in Mo Bay at Toby's for 2 days. I used Clives Transportaion to travel between the 2 areas, $18 each way. After coming from Negril I was a bit disappointed by MoBay. Was not as nice and relaxing as Negril. Toby's was fine considering the price. The staff was very nice, the rooms were clean and the location was convenient. The best things about MoBay were Doctor's Cave Beach and Pier 1 Restaurant. I would probably not go back there for vacation when there are other areas in Jamaica that are much nicer.

We stayed at Tobys twice, on both occasions one night when passing through Montego Bay. The first time we had a standard room, which was pretty basic so I asked for a better room the second time and this was much better. However, I think calling this place a "resort" is going a bit far. I wouldn´t want to spend too much time there. They advertise 2 pools, one with waterfall. The waterfall was not working on either of our visits. The food on our first visit was awful, so we went elsewhere the second time. Don´t get too excited about the "hip strip" it isn´t very hip! However, Toby´s is close to the airport, which makes it very convenient.

If you are looking for a clean room at a great location for a good price in 'MoBay,' then Toby's is a wonderful choice. Just a few steps from a public beach and 2 blocks from (~5 min walk) for Doctor's Cove beach and Margaritaville, Toby's is close enough to all the action, yet far enough to get a quiet nights (or mornings) rest. TIP: There are a few public beaches in MoBay, however, if you don't want to be hassled by locals asking for money (lots of beggers in Jamaica), then Doctor's Cove beach ($5 US entrance and optional $5 for a beach chair and $5 for an umbrella) is perfect for a quiet afternoon of sunbathing

We stayed at Tobys 24-27 February and the weather was perfect. We ususally stay at all-inclusive, but found it a waste of money - we hardly eat at the hotel. The hotel was comfortable, clean and pretty quiet. Our room was on the street side and not that much noise. The restuarant service and food was good, thanks to the staff. The front desk was very friendly. The only thing that I didn't like was they only gave out one key. Other than that everything was great. Since Tobys in right at the beginning of the hip strip - it was nice to walk to Margarittaville, the shops and shops anytime we wanted to. Great time again in Jamaica - my choice of best places to visit.
